I was told that warrants still decay every day, including Saturday and Sunday, so if you bought on Friday, you have 3-4 days decay almost a weeks decay before you blink on Monday. AND the issuers rip us off - hint hint. Note that I think SBank is not the worst. The issuers move their spread up and down to make money - you are nothing in this game! I am now trying to trade warrants only Monday to Thursday, and maybe Friday - definitely trying to sell into the weekend. Simon's comment refers I think to the reference being that the TOP40 warrants and waves are all referenced and hedged to the Futures, which us at OST can't see - hint hint Simon!!!
